I had actually the opposite. Some assholes from fantasy world thinking no-magic world would be an easy prey on one side and X-COM-like organisation on the other.

Only there was one big difference from standard "humans versus fantasy" plot. The other side was competent.

Eventully from largely secret small-scale invasion with attempted control over governments it grew into all-out war with both sides resembling each other more and more as it went by. Eventually it became clear that things are creeping pretty close to MAD and, a couple of coups later (the final session of the campaign - party had to infiltrate the palace of fantasyland's Dragon Emperor and slay him, with valuable, yet deniable assistance from his no less assholish, but more agreeable brother) things cooled down enough for both sides to negotiate peace.

It was pretty dope and i want to run the followup campaign, 200 or so years later.

I've done an entire setting like this. The concept was that the players were doing EXACTLY this...With one caveat.

They had to pretend to be natives. As in, they couldn't bust out the heavy weaponry and so on. All of them were trained combatants, from academies on Earth. (The one twist was that for the magicians, their magic didn't work on Earth. They had very elaborate simulations to make up for it.)

Also, the players were actually film stars back home. People watched their gory adventures, and thrilled to their exploits. They started wars, assassinated Kings, battled dragons...All to live a seven-figure life back on Earth.

And here's the funny thing: One of the players was a Paladin. Now, in this universe, Paladins must worship Gods (Like Clerics) to get their powers. The PC - who fought with chivalry and honor - was known as the Devil Knight, because he was not of this Earth.

Because his God knew, you see, and saw to the true heart of this man. And since his faith was true, God allowed him to serve and wield his powers anyway.
